My post today features the Goth Girl clear stamp set, with 3 different rubber background stamps, a slimline die, and a nested die set...

I started out with the Slimline Marquee die and cut it out 3 times, once in the lime green cardstock (which I also used for my card frame), once with white cardstock, and once with purple cardstock.

Then I stamped the specific insert pieces, all with black ink using the Goth Skulls background, the Curly Q's background, and the Checkerboard Doodle background.

I popped up the Marquee frame with foam tape then adhered the insert pieces flat on my black card base.



The skull is from the Goth Girl set, and I just stamped it in black, and fussy cut it out then popped it up with foam tape too. Oh and I added a Starry Sky Sparkletz to each of his eyes...which fit just right.


To complete my card, I stamped the sentiment (also from Goth Girl), on black card stock and heat embossed it in white. Then I die cut it using the smallest Wavy Nested Frame and glued it to the front.

I have a quick card for you today that starts out with the Formal Lattice stencil. I just randomly sponged on some distress inks (shaded lilac and salty ocean) and then spattered some picked raspberry distress inks on top using a toothbrush to get the fine speckles.


I stamped the upper corner with the dangling hearts from the FaDoodles Too stamp set (designed by the lovely and ridiculously talented Faye Wynn-Jones) and then colored them in with picked raspberry distress marker.


The sentiments are from the You're My Always clear stamp set. If you're not familiar with this collection of sentiments they are really versatile, there are several sets that you can build your own sentiments with and many of the sets work interchangeably too. You can check out all of them HERE.
